Москва,
территория инновационного центра «Сколково»,
Большой бульвар, д. 42, стр. 1

+7 495 780-08-95

доб. 505

3-participant-ru-120x85.png

Inspark. IoT Platform. Архитектура

Inspark. IoT Platform является по-настоящему комплексной платформой IoT, которая полностью удовлетворяет всем современным требованиям к IoT- архитектуре.

 

Без компромиссов. 

Гибкая модульная структура и открытый API позволяют системным интеграторам встраивать Inspark. IoT Platform в готовую экосистему заказчика, без ограничений развивать функциональность и имплементировать ее в состав собственных продуктов.

DEVICE MANAGEMENT

EXTERNAL INTERFACES

ANALYTICS

DATA VISUALIZATION

PROCESSING & ACTION MANAGEMENT

CONNECTIVITY & NORMALIZATION

DATABASE

EXTERNAL INTERFACES

Inspark. IoT Platform имеет развитый набор API, который позволяет системным интеграторам встраивать Платформу в готовую экосистему заказчика, без ограничений развивать функциональность и имплементировать ее в состав собственных продуктов.

ANALYTICS

Практически все потребности в оперативной аналитике в Inspark. IoT Platform реализованы на уровне DataVisualization. Представленные на этом уровне приложения позволяют проводить ретроспективный и realtime сравнительный анализ данных, собираемых системой. 
Для специализированных аналитических задач Inspark. IoT Platform осуществляет специальную подготовку и хранения данных для использования сторонними аналитическими системами и системами машинного обучения. На данный момент пользователям предоставляется настроенная интеграция с одним из самых мощных аналитических сервисов - Microsoft Power Bi.

DATA VISUALIZATION

Пользовательский интерфейс Платформы. Реализован в виде набора гибких настраиваемых приложений для работы пользователей с системой.

PROCESSING & ACTION MANAGEMENT

“Двигатель” платформы. На данном уровне в Inspark. IoT Platform производится обработка поступающих данных, контролируются изменения параметров и генерируются события для отработки другими уровнями архитектуры (переключение устройств, информирование пользователей и т.д.).

DEVICE MANAGEMENT

Удаленное управление и контроль состоянием устройств, обновление прошивки, установка пакетов ПО. 

DATABASE

Inspark. IoT Platform удовлетворяет всем специфическим требованиям к СУБД платформы IoT:

- возможность хранить большое количество данных;

- поддержка специальных типов данных от сенсоров и датчиков;

- высокая производительность обработки потоковых данных;

- поддержка механизмов достоверности (в практике, устройства и датчики могут иметь выбросы, пересылать шум и т.д.).

CONNECTIVITY & NORMALIZATION

На уровне Connectivity выполняется задача приведения различных протоколов и форматов данных в один «программный» интерфейс.

 
В Inspark.IoT Platform, возможны оба варианта решений уровня Connectivity:

- устройства предоставляют API

- устройства поддерживают протоколы IoT.

 

Взаимодействие с такими устройствами осуществляется back-end компонентами платформы.

 

На устройство устанавливается специальный агент платформы. Устройства, не поддерживающие протоколов IoT подключаются через контроллер, который обеспечивает взаимодействие платформы с ними.

Наравне с облачной технологией в Inspark. IoT Platform реализована концепция периферийных вычислений (edge computing).

У платформы есть важный и ключевой элемент – специализированное ПО контроллера (edge), которое приближает архитектурные элементы платформы непосредственно к объекту управления.

Платформа может делегировать на edge уровень часть важных функций, связанных с анализом и принятием решений по управлению объектами.

Это позволяет добиваться:

- быстрой реакции на поведение объекта;

- независимости от состояния канала связи с серверной компонентой;

- селективного взаимодействия с сервером (по необходимости, по событию, по правилам и т.д.).